Address code review feedback: improve documentation and UTC timezone handling
- Added Field description to BaseEvent timestamp for better clarity - Updated crewai_event_bus.emit() to use UTC timezone for consistency - Improved test reliability by removing time.sleep() dependencies - Enhanced documentation for emit() method with detailed docstring - Added comprehensive type checks and UTC timezone assertions in tests - Improved error messages and edge case coverage in test assertions Addresses feedback from PR review by joaomdmoura Co-Authored-By: João <joao@crewai.com>
